Transaction 7faea75050f643c928f0ea37ddb9f102c6b4cdd537909640cb557f4d44598dd2
4 Input
2 Outputs
- 7faea75050f643c928f0ea37ddb9f102c6b4cdd537909640cb557f4d44598dd2:0
- 7faea75050f643c928f0ea37ddb9f102c6b4cdd537909640cb557f4d44598dd2:1
value 1670
address 14QiHoW5UqVCciMdHTTb3BszLBTuyEmsEk
value 292873
address 3FEsuU3G37mPEKVZAcxSwk2NbJYPEL2hDt